How to Remove Sentinel Agent Windows 10: A Step-by-Step Guide

Removing the Sentinel Agent from a Windows 10 computer involves stopping its services, uninstalling the agent software, and cleaning up any remaining files. This guide will walk you through the process step by step, ensuring you safely and effectively remove the Sentinel Agent from your system.

How to Remove Sentinel Agent Windows 10

In the following steps, you will learn how to completely remove the Sentinel Agent from your Windows 10 computer. Carefully following each step will ensure no remnants are left behind.

Step 1: Open the Services Window

First, you need to access the Services window where you can stop the Sentinel Agent services.

To do this, press the Windows key + R to open the Run dialog box, type “services.msc,” and press Enter. This will open the Services management console, where you can see all the running services on your computer.

Step 2: Locate Sentinel Agent Services

Next, find the Sentinel Agent services in the list.

Scroll through the list until you find services related to Sentinel Agent. They might be named something like “SentinelAgent” or “SentinelOne.” Once you find them, take note of their names.

Step 3: Stop Sentinel Agent Services

Stop the Sentinel Agent services to prepare for uninstallation.

Right-click on each Sentinel Agent service and select “Stop.” This action will halt the services, preventing them from running during the uninstallation process.

Step 4: Open Control Panel

Now, open the Control Panel to uninstall the Sentinel Agent program.

Press the Windows key, type “Control Panel,” and hit Enter. When the Control Panel opens, navigate to “Programs” and then “Programs and Features.”

Step 5: Uninstall Sentinel Agent

Select the Sentinel Agent program and uninstall it.

In the list of installed programs, find the Sentinel Agent application, click on it, and then select “Uninstall.” Follow the prompts to complete the uninstallation process.

Step 6: Delete Remaining Files

Remove any leftover files and folders related to Sentinel Agent.

Open File Explorer and navigate to the installation directory of Sentinel Agent (usually in Program Files). Delete any remaining files or folders associated with the agent.

Step 7: Clean the Registry

Finally, clean up the Windows Registry to remove any leftover entries.

Press the Windows key + R, type “regedit,” and press Enter to open the Registry Editor. Carefully search for and delete any registry entries related to Sentinel Agent. Be cautious and only delete entries specific to Sentinel Agent to avoid damaging your system.

After completing these steps, Sentinel Agent will be completely removed from your Windows 10 computer, freeing up system resources and ensuring no related processes are running.

Frequently Asked Questions

What is Sentinel Agent?

Sentinel Agent is security software designed to protect computers from malware and other cyber threats. It monitors system activity and can block suspicious behavior.

Why would I need to remove Sentinel Agent?

You might need to remove Sentinel Agent if you’re experiencing system performance issues, conflicts with other software, or if you no longer require its protection.

Can I reinstall Sentinel Agent after removing it?

Yes, you can reinstall Sentinel Agent by downloading the installation package from the official website and following the provided instructions.

Is it safe to edit the Windows Registry?

Editing the Windows Registry can be risky if you’re not careful. Always backup the registry before making changes, and only delete entries you’re sure are related to the software you’re removing.

What if Sentinel Agent won’t uninstall?

If Sentinel Agent won’t uninstall, try using a third-party uninstaller tool or booting your computer into Safe Mode to perform the uninstallation.
